Correlation

The correlation between QHFIX and QSPRX is 0.23,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.

Drawdowns

QHFIX vs. QSPRX - Drawdown Comparison

The maximum QHFIX drawdown since its inception was -13.85%, smaller than the maximum QSPRX drawdown of -41.22%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for QHFIX and QSPRX.
